In March 2016 I was sent to the hospital for an emergent Salpingectomy. My family wasn't with me, so I employed a nursing assistant to take care of myself. At the late night, a tall and thin nurse named Hongfang Yu on night shift told me it was the time for me to eat something like porridge but it was too late to get the food. My nursing assistant was not able to buy anything for me.
When Hongfang Yu learned that I could not get anything to eat, she generously gave her porridge to me without hesitation. I wanted to pay her back, but she refused. I instructed my nursing assistant to give her a bottle of milk that night and buy her some porridge the next morning. To my surprise, I saw a bowl of porridge and a paper note on my bedside table when I woke up in the morning.
The note said: "Thank you, I've already got a bottle of milk from you and this bowl of porridge is good for your health. I think you're a person with stories and I recommend you a WeChat official account named "Do our best to live" which publishes articles with life philosophies. This may be of some help to you. I'm also following this account." It indeed touched me greatly I even remember now. I felt so grateful for what Hongfang Yu did for me and shared with me.
